Maggie’s Locations

Date Everything Maggie Location

Maggie claims a cozy spot on the wall near the piano, which serves as a reliable checkpoint throughout your encounters. While she may shift locations as you explore, her reminders about her whereabouts will help ensure you never lose track of her.

How to Negotiate Your Relationship with Maggie

Date Everything Maggie About Her

Maggie stands out as one of the most charming and engaging dateables in the game, with her narrative revolving around two central mysteries. The first involves the enigmatic Scandalabra, also affectionately known as Jon Wick, while the second centers on the notable Sinclaire. Successfully navigating these mysteries not only propels you toward either romance or friendship but also presents the risk of earning Maggie’s disdain if mismanaged.

Maggie’s Love/Friendship Path

Date Everything Maggie Love&Friendship Path

Upon completing the last case, you’ll be faced with a pivotal choice: fostering a friendship with Maggie or pursuing a deeper romantic connection. Should you err and fail at one of the investigative cases, you will inadvertently shift to the Friendship path, effectively barring yourself from love—a detail worth considering, as relationships with other characters might also be affected.

As the romantic tension escalates, one of the collectibles becomes available. A subsequent opportunity for celebration with Maggie follows, providing you yet another collectible.

Maggie’s Hate Path

Date Everything Maggie Hate Path

While navigating the Hate path mirrors the general narrative, you’ll be confronted with choices that might feel uncharacteristically silly. Selectivity is key: choose to ignore Maggie’s feelings or act in a way that purposely frustrates her. Notably, you’ll need to answer incorrectly on two out of three cases and maintain a dismissive demeanor during your dialogues.

To truly achieve this conclusion, consistently deny Maggie’s feelings, racking up enough negativity points to secure her discontent. Given the complexities of this route, pursuing the Love/Friendship path may prove to be a more gratifying experience.

Maggie’s Collectibles

Date Everything Maggie Collectibles

Within her narrative, Maggie offers three collectibles that you can collect during your interactions. One collectible is acquired early in the storyline, while the remaining two emerge as you delve deeper into her investigations.

To fully capture all of Maggie’s collectibles, it is essential to navigate her love path flawlessly. Any deviation can result in missing out on her collectibles, as they are exclusively attainable via the love route. Furthermore, since engaging with multiple characters adds to the overall richness of the gameplay, pursuing the love path is highly advantageous.

Even after concluding her narrative arc, Maggie remains a valuable source of rumors—only if you’ve maintained a positive relationship with her.
